What is strategic competitive intelligence?

Strategic Competitive Intelligence is the process of gathering, analyzing, and using information about competitors, market trends, and the broader business environment to inform strategic decision-making. Professionals in this field help organizations anticipate market shifts, identify opportunities and threats, and maintain a competitive edge. This involves using both public and proprietary sources, ethical data collection, and delivering actionable insights to leadership teams. The goal is to support business strategy, product development, and long-term planning.

How does a strategic competitive intelligence professional typ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

Strategic Competitive Intelligence professionals work closely with teams across marketing, product development, sales, and executive leadership to gather relevant market data and translate it into actionable insights. They often facilitate cross-functional meetings, share competitor analyses, and support strategic planning efforts by providing timely, data-driven recommendations. This collaboration ensures that all departments are aligned with the latest industry trends and can proactively address competitive threats, ultimately strengthening the organization's market position.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a strategic competitive intelligence profess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Strategic Competitive Intelligence professional, you need strong analytical abilities, business acumen, research skills, and typically a degree in business, economics, or a related field. Familiarity with competitive intelligence software, advanced data analytics tools, and market research platforms is often required. Excellent communication, critical thinking, and discretion are soft skills that help professionals effectively synthesize and present sensitive information. These skills are vital for providing actionable insights that inform strategic decisions and give organizations a competitive edge.

What is the difference between Strategic Competitive Intelligence vs Market Research Analyst?

AspectStrategic Competitive IntelligenceMarket Research Analyst
CredentialsBachelor's degree in Business, Marketing, or related fields; certifications like SCIPBachelor's degree in Marketing, Business, or Statistics
Work EnvironmentCorporate strategy teams, consulting firmsMarket research firms, corporate marketing departments
Industry UsageUsed for strategic planning, competitive positioningUsed for consumer insights, product development
FocusAnalyzing competitors, industry trends, strategic opportunitiesGathering and analyzing consumer data, market trends

While both roles involve analyzing market data, Strategic Competitive Intelligence focuses on understanding competitors and industry dynamics to inform strategic decisions. Market Research Analysts primarily gather consumer insights to guide marketing and product strategies. The former is more strategic and competitor-focused, whereas the latter emphasizes consumer behavior and market trends.

About the Role

The Director, Proposal Management provides executive leadership for the enterprise-wide proposal function, driving strategy, process excellence, and competitive success across major pursuits. This role combines deep proposal expertise with responsibility for building high-performing teams, establishing best-in-class processes, and delivering winning proposals aligned with corporate growth objectives. The successful candidate will direct multiple high-value proposal efforts simultaneously, improve win rates through sophisticated quality processes, and foster an ethical, values-driven culture.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provides executive leadership for enterprise-wide proposal management, developing strategies that align with corporate growth objectives and market positioning.
  • Directs multiple high-value, complex proposal efforts simultaneously, optimizing resources and maintaining quality standards for compelling, compliant submissions.
  • Builds and leads high-performing proposal teams, establishing clear roles, fostering collaboration, and creating development pathways.
  • Implements sophisticated review processes and quality standards that significantly improve win rates and ensure best practice consistency.
  • Translates capture strategies into winning proposals by partnering with business development, technical, and executive leadership to address client needs and create differentiation.
  • Crafts executive-level proposal narratives, win themes, and strategic messaging for high-stakes opportunities.
  • Establishes efficient proposal processes, tools, and templates that ensure compliance and enable scalable growth.
  • Maintains deep understanding of government acquisition, procurement regulations, and evaluation criteria, anticipating trends to maintain competitive advantage.
  • Advises executive leadership on proposal strategy, competitive positioning, and win probability for bid/no-bid decisions.
  • Drives continuous improvement through innovative methodologies, automation tools, and lessons-learned integration.
  • Fosters cross-functional partnerships across business development, capture, contracts, pricing, and technical organizations.
  • Models company values, holds teams accountable to ethical standards, and ensures integrity throughout all proposal activities.
  • Establishes performance metrics and win-rate analytics that drive accountability and improvement.
  • Represents the company in industry forums and maintains awareness of competitive intelligence and best practices.
  • Manages proposal budgets, resource planning, and infrastructure investments.
